Abstract

The utility model provides a kind of self-cleaning filter uninterruptedly fed, including:Housing, housing sidewall offer feed inlet, are equipped with central tube in housing, the part that central tube is located at outside housing offers cleaner liquid discharge port;Multiple filtering ring flat-plates, each filtering ring flat-plate is circular hollow cavity structure, spacer is arranged on central tube periphery to multiple filtering ring flat-plates between the upper and lower, and each inner ring surface for filtering ring flat-plate is adjacent to central tube outer circumferential surface, and filtering ring flat-plate inner ring surface offers interconnected material mouth with central tube outer circumferential surface;Scum pipe, it is located at central tube side, and scum pipe lower end is stretched out outside housing, the part that scum pipe is located at outside housing offers slag-drip opening, scum pipe periphery is from top to bottom connected equipped with multiple suction nozzles, and each suction nozzle is respectively positioned between neighbouring two filterings ring flat-plate, and suction nozzle is close to filtering ring flat-plate.The self-cleaning filter uninterruptedly fed of the utility model, it can be rapidly completed self-cleaning process in the case of uninterrupted input and output material.

Background technology
For needing by backwashing regenerated Full-automatic filter system, in order to ensure that the life of continuous-stable can be obtained Production, is generally adopted by the configuration mode that a sets filtering device includes two filters, in normal work, in fact only one Platform filters, and another spare wait, but needs supporting a fairly large number of valve, instrument, the PLC system of complexity and more Supporting auxiliary device, so causing the of high cost of the device, operation requires height, and space is big.So not too much it is suitable for Some feedstock properties are good, the user of limited space.And existing filtration system does not have Check System, or moved by additional Power carries out deslagging, and energy consumption is big, inconvenient for use.

As shown in Fig. 1~5, a kind of self-cleaning filter uninterruptedly fed, including:
Housing 1,1 side wall of housing offer feed inlet 11, central tube 2, the central tube 2 are equipped with the housing 1 Lower end is stretched out outside housing 1, and the part that the central tube 2 is located at outside housing 1 offers cleaner liquid discharge port 21;Multiple filtering ring flat-plates 3, each ring flat-plate 3 that filters is circular hollow cavity structure, multiple filtering ring flat-plates about 3 spacer sleeve be arranged on 2 periphery of central tube, The inner ring surface of each filtering ring flat-plate 3 is adjacent to 2 outer circumferential surface of central tube, and filtering 3 inner ring surface of ring flat-plate is opened up with 2 outer circumferential surface of central tube There is interconnected material mouth;Scum pipe 4, it is located at 2 side of central tube, and 4 lower end of scum pipe is stretched out outside housing 1, scum pipe 4 Slag-drip opening 41 is offered in the part outside housing 1,4 periphery of scum pipe is from top to bottom connected equipped with multiple suction nozzles, each to inhale Mouth is respectively positioned between neighbouring two filterings ring flat-plate 3, and suction nozzle is close to filtering ring flat-plate 3.
The self-cleaning filter uninterruptedly fed of the utility model, at work, enters housing 1 from feed inlet 11 It is interior, 3 surface of filtering ring flat-plate is then passed through, since filtering ring flat-plate 3 is circular hollow cavity structure, filtered 3 surface of ring flat-plate Enter into the inner cavity of filtering ring flat-plate 3, then by the inner cavity of filtering ring flat-plate 3 in central tube 2, eventually pass through cleaner liquid discharge port 21 Filtering is completed in outflow;Filter residue is constantly deposited on filtering ring flat-plate 3 surface in filter process, when filtering proceeds to a certain degree, this When open slag-drip opening 41, since the pressure of feed inlet 11 is far longer than the pressure at slag-drip opening 41, the pressure in housing 1 is more than row Pressure in cinder notch 41, be deposited on filtering ring flat-plate 3 under the action of 1 external and internal pressure difference of housing, by suction nozzle inspiration scum pipe 4 again Enter through slag-drip opening 41 in slag liquid collection device, complete tapping process.
In another technical solution, the self-cleaning filter uninterruptedly fed, further includes two pressure sensings Device, two pressure sensors detect filtering 3 external and internal pressure value of ring flat-plate respectively, when filtering 3 external and internal pressure difference of ring flat-plate reaches preset value When, open slag-drip opening 41.During the technical program, by setting two pressure sensors on housing 1, two pressure pass Sensor detects filtering 3 external and internal pressure value of ring flat-plate respectively, and as filtering carries out, filter residue is constantly deposited on 3 surface of filtering ring flat-plate, at this time Cause to filter 3 surface of ring flat-plate and inner cavity forms pressure differential, when pressure differential reaches setting value, it is meant that the filter residue on filtering ring flat-plate 3 Reache a certain level, open slag-drip opening 41 at this time, start to start self-cleaning process, be deposited on the filtering external pressure in housing 1 of ring flat-plate 3 Under the action of force difference, entered again through slag-drip opening 41 in slag liquid collection device in suction nozzle inspiration scum pipe 4, complete tapping process.
In another technical solution, the filtering ring flat-plate 3 further includes circular support frame, and support frame was sheathed on In the annular compartment for filtering ring flat-plate 3.By setting circular support frame in filtering ring flat-plate 3, certain branch is played to filtering ring flat-plate 3 Support acts on, the intensity of increase filtering ring flat-plate 3.
In another technical solution, the self-cleaning filter uninterruptedly fed, is communicated with a pipe on suction nozzle 51 Road 5, the pipeline 5 are connected with scum pipe 4, and the pipeline 5 is projected as arc-shaped in the horizontal plane.Suction nozzle 51 passes through after drawing filter residue Piping 5 enters in scum pipe 4.
In another technical solution, the self-cleaning filter uninterruptedly fed, 4 lower end of scum pipe is also associated with One decelerating motor, decelerating motor, which rotates, can drive scum pipe 4 to rotate;2 lower end of central tube is connected to an electric rotating machine, electric rotating machine Rotate and drive central tube 2 to rotate.The electric rotating machine of 2 lower end of central tube connection, in filtering, electric rotating machine, which rotates, drives central tube 2 rotate accelerated filtration process, and decelerating motor can be opened in tapping process, and decelerating motor, which rotates, drives scum pipe 4 to rotate, and then Suction nozzle 51 is set to swing back and forth on filtering ring flat-plate 3, so that the filter residue filtered on ring flat-plate 3 be siphoned away.

In another technical solution, the self-cleaning filter uninterruptedly fed, is coaxially provided with scum pipe 4 One rotating bar 6, upper end and the scum pipe 4 of first rotating bar 6 are connected, and 6 lower face of the first rotating bar offers the first groove 61, the first rotating bar 6 is located at the top of the first groove 61 and offers the second groove 62 connected with the first groove 61, the second groove 62 Diameter is more than 61 diameter of the first groove, and 7 upper end of the second rotating bar is rotated through the first groove 61, the second groove 62, described second Thread fitting between 7 and first groove 61 of bar, the end that second rotating bar 7 is located in the second groove are fixed with a convex block 72, The convex block 72 can be moved up and down along 62 axis direction of the second groove, between 7 lower end of the second rotating bar and scum pipe 4 leave Every interval height is more than the height of the second groove 62;Second rotating bar, 7 periphery be located at the first groove 61, the second groove 62 it Outer part is interval with multigroup arc-shaped strip piece up and down, and every group of arc-shaped strip piece includes multiple along the second rotating bar week To the arc-shaped strip piece 71 of arrangement.
In the technical program, scum pipe 4, which rotates, drives the first rotating bar 6 to rotate, due to the second rotating bar 7 and first turn It is threadedly coupled between the first groove 61 in lever 6, the first rotating bar 6, which rotates, makes the convex block 72 along second of the second rotating bar 7 recessed Groove 62, which moves up and down, drives the first rotating bar 6 to move up and down, and the filter residue in scum pipe 4 can so, which smoothly fallen, prevents from blocking up Plug;Second rotating bar 7 is equipped with multigroup arc-shaped strip piece, and every group of arc-shaped strip piece includes multiple circular arcs circumferentially arranged Shape strip piece 71, when the second rotating bar 7 moves up and down, arc-shaped strip piece 71 can indulge the filter residue in scum pipe 4 To cutting, filter residue is disperseed, filter residue is smoothly fallen prevents from blocking.
In another technical solution, the self-cleaning filter uninterruptedly fed, decelerating motor slows down for stepping Motor.Stepper motor can make Direct/Reverse carry out back rotation, so that the second rotating bar 7 in scum pipe moves up and down.
